How can a single camera do that? My experience with computer vision is fairly limited so I'm curious how that would work. My understanding is you need to be able to generate a point map, stereo vision, or some non-CV related method , e.g. radar like the pixel 4. 2D depth estimation can be done with a single camera in somewhat useful way but it's not a secure way (https://github.com/nianticlabs/monodepth2 -- now somewhat similar functionality in OpenCV). nianticlabs/monodepth2 is an open source project licensed under GNU General Public License v3.0 or later which is an OSI approved license.
The primary programming language of monodepth2 is Jupyter Notebook.
